Kingdom Rush Alliance Impossible Hero Challenge - 22. Starving Hollow Iron

This bonus campaign closes out with a reasonably challenging iron mode.  Despite being a map that needs a decent amount of AoE, I had trouble getting a Battle Brewmaster build off the ground and found it easier to go all-in with Twilight Longbows.  They really come into their own as the fight progresses, being invaluable in taking down Killertiles and Tankzards.  Besides that there's really no trick to this one other than just fighting as hard as possible.

Impressions

We have some very surprising grades this time around.  Stregi being at the bottom with a 'C' isn't surprising of course, but Anya joining her somewhat is.  This is just one of those maps that highlights heroes with DPS problems, and Anya is definitely one of them.  Normally her great survivability and solid hero spell keep her from hitting rock bottom, but this time around that just wasn't the case.

Of course I say all that and then Warhead somehow earns himself a very rare 'A-'.  Of course his hero spell is pretty clutch on this level, but still I was shocked how easy it was to do this one with him.  But then to prove it truly is Opposite Day, Onagro only manages a 'B' here.  Throughout campaign and heroic modes I worried that his mobility issues would be a big problem and they just weren't, but again this map for whatever reason really hits that weakness hard.

And then as the cherry on top, Broden does not earn his usual 'A+', only getting an 'A'.  His performance just didn't have the trivializing feel that it normally does.  And while Kosmyr is usually the one coming in just below him with an unadorned 'A', he somehow tops him to get the 'A+' himself.

I'm certainly not going to complain about a map that shakes things up grade-wise, I just wish I could identify the particular aspects of it that make it that way.  It's not like the map has a particularly unusual wave composition, or that they're asking you to do something really hard like take down high armor enemies with no magic towers, but man this one was just weird.

Kingdom Rush Alliance Impossible Hero Challenge - 22. Starving Hollow Heroic

We bounce back from campaign mode to a pretty trivial heroic mode.  I believe that a single hero solution here is probably possible, but honestly I just didn't have it in me to spend the time searching for it.  I'm feeling so terribly behind on this series with the recent release of the second Alliance DLC that I desperately just want to get caught up.  Fortunately I have no intentions of playing the imminent new game, Kingdom Rush Battles, so it's release cycle should buy me the time I need to get caught up on the franchise.  In case you're wondering why I'm not going to play it, it's a PvP-focused game, and I'm avoiding PvP games in this stage of my life like the plague for multiple reasons I won't bore you with right now.

Right, back to the map.  As usual, the only tricky part are the Winged Croks coming in from the top right.  Two level four Royal Archers are almost enough to deal with them by themselves, so as long as your hero can contribute a little something to taking them down - hero spell or otherwise - everything else is pretty straightforward.  There's only one exit to deal with, thankfully, so we load up the choke point with Tricannons with Bombardment, and I can't tell you how much that warms my heart.  Even Hydras can't withstand three Tricannons constantly raining death on them, and for most of our heroes we don't even really need to upgrade the Paladins much if at all - easy peasy.

Impressions

Since it was pretty easy using two heroes everyone gets a chance to pad their GPA a little.  In case you haven't figured it out, I've really stopped trying to account for using the second hero in the grades.  It was just getting too hard to adjudicate and account for, and the result is that everyone but Stregi lands in 'B' tier or better, with quite a number in 'A' tier.  That includes Anya and Warhead, which is a bit of a rarity for them.  Even Raelyn earns a rare (for her) 'B+'.
